About us

At Bright Valley Care, we are an independent residential children's home provider dedicated to providing compassionate, trauma-informed care for children and young people who are unable to live at home. Our mission is to create a safe, nurturing environment where each child can heal, grow, and thrive. With a deep understanding of the complex needs of children in care, our team is committed to offering a therapeutic approach that focuses on building trusting relationships, fostering emotional resilience, and supporting positive life outcomes. We believe that every child deserves a loving, stable home, and we work tirelessly to ensure that our care not only meets their immediate needs but also empowers them for a brighter future. Rooted in the principles of trauma-responsive care, our goal is to provide a place where children feel valued, understood, and supported on their journey towards healing and hope.

Meet the Directors

  • Babar Zaheer

    With over a decade of dedicated experience in the childcare industry, Babar has held a wide range of roles that have equipped him with a deep understanding of both frontline care and strategic leadership. He holds a Level 3 Diploma in Residential Childcare and a Level 5 Diploma in Leadership and Management, which have further strengthened his professional capabilities and leadership approach.

    Throughout his career, Babar has played a key role in the setup, development, and management of multiple children’s homes, each designed to provide safe, nurturing, and supportive environments where young people can feel valued and thrive. He has a proven track record of working closely with Ofsted, ensuring full regulatory compliance and consistently achieving positive inspection outcomes. His work has focused on building strong, resilient teams, embedding effective care practices, and maintaining the highest standards of care and governance.

    From early on in his career, it was always Babar’s vision to one day become a provider himself and open his own children’s homes. His extensive hands-on experience, regulatory knowledge, and passion for delivering meaningful, child-focused care naturally led him to take that next step. Today, Babar’s homes reflect his unwavering commitment to quality, compassion, and putting the needs of children at the heart of everything he does.

  • Usman Farooq

    Usman has many years of experience working in therapeutic settings and has served as a registered manager. He has achieved positive outcomes for young people and has proven himself to be an excellent leader. Furthermore, Usman has a strong track record in OFSTED-regulated services, consistently receiving excellent feedback during inspections.

    Usman holds a level 5 in leadership and management along with a level 3 in residential childcare.
